Charterhouse Lagos, A unique educational institution that offers world-class education

Lagos, the bustling heart of Nigeria and its economic hub is a beacon of unparalleled education and has emerged, promising to redefine the way premium schooling is perceived.

Following its launch in September 2023, Charterhouse Lagos has swiftly garnered attention, with parents eager to enrol their children in the first British independent school in West Africa. With its 400 years of rich British heritage and commitment to exceptional education, this prestigious institution stands out as a game-changer in the realm of premium education in Nigeria and West Africa.

State-of-the-Art Facilities

Its state-of-the-art facilities show the school’s commitment to providing the best learning environment. Every aspect of Charterhouse Lagos’ 700,000-square-metre campus is designed to enhance the learning experience with a superior focus on its five-star facilities as follows:

  • Science-Tech- Engineering-Mathematics (STEM) labs
  • Music, Art, and Drama studios
  • An Aquatics Centre (a 25m swimming pool and a training pool)
  • Indoor and outdoor Football pitches and Basketball courts
  • Gymnasium
  • A Welcome Centre
  • Dining Hall
  • A 257-seat Lecture Theatre 
  • A Medical Centre
  • An Operations Centre 
  • A Central Administration Building
  • Teachers’ Apartments
